Specifically, a materialized view is considered complex if the materialized view definition query contains:

  • A CONNECT BY clause
  • An INTERSECT , MINUS , or UNION ALL operation
  • he DISTINCT or UNIQUE keyword
  • In some cases, an aggregate function, although it is possible to have an aggregation function in the query definition and always have a simple materialized view
  • In some cases, joins other than those in a subquery, although it is possible to have joins in the definition to interrogate and still have a simple materialized view
  • In some cases, a UNION operation

ON COMMIT

Refresh product automatically when a transaction which changed one of the paintings of the materialized view's retail is committed. This can be specified as the materialized view is quickly updatable (in other words, not complex). The ON COMMIT privilege is required to use this mode.

ON DEMAND

Refresh occurs when a user manually executes one of the procedures available refresh contained in the DBMS_MVIEW package ( REFRESH , REFRESH_ALL_MVIEWS , REFRESH_DEPENDENT ).

COMPLETE

Refreshes and recalculating the materialized view query definition.

FAST

Applies incremental changes to refresh the materialized view using the information recorded in the papers of the materialized view, or an SQL * Loader direct-path access or a partition maintenance operation.

FORCE

Applies FAST update if possible; otherwise, it applies COMPLETE Refresh.

NEVER

Indicates that the materialized view will not be updated with updating mechanisms.

Answer: It depends.

If you do a full refresh, then the default is to use ATOMIC_REFRESH = TRUE.

This means that the update is done via an insert, delete , and ... Select.

You can change it to ATOMIC_REFRESH = FALSE (parameter dbms_mview.refresh).

This means that is a TRUNCATE and insert a ... Select with APPEND peak (path direct insert).

Refresh if Atomic = FALSE is considerably faster than the default. Also way less Archives of newspapers are written.

The downside is however that, during the update the MV is empty, is no longer an atomar operation!

    You are showing much more than 2.30 minutes in this result tkprof - did you mean hours?

    We use parallel and base are partitioned. When I checked the tkprof report I see a lot of insert query expects especially PX Deq Credit: send blkd event.

    In your case, it seems as if the "PX Deq Credit: send blkd" is an inactive waiting (despite comments in the manual, which is not always true).
    Plan execution tells you that you are not loading in the GL_BAL_MV at the same time (even if you select it in parallel). This means a single process must collect all the data of all the slaves of PX to insert it, so anytime 7 slaves will wait for you "PX Deq Credit: send blkd" while the eighth sends data to the query Coordinator to write to the table. (The timeout on these waiting 2 seconds - which is consistent with the max wait the values you see.)

    If you can ensure that the MV and its index is declared as parallel, and you can enable parallel DML for updating, you may find that things go a lot faster.

    It is possible, moreover, that your plan has changed over time - there are a couple of "HASH JOIN TAMPONNÉE" in the plan, which means that the table "probe" the hash join arrives on the assembling process and is dumped to disk (if it does not fit in memory) to be reread and joined. This can consume a lot of IO and the time - as seen by the "pr = 1158765 pw = 1158765" on line 4 of your plan. It is possible that a previous plan has used a method of dissemination for the table of 'building' avoid this overload - but that the optimizer has switched plans as all data has increased.

    Hello

    Select LAST_REFRESH_TYPE in the ALL_MVIEWS. This field contains the following information:

    Method used for the most recent update:

    -COMPLETE - last update has completed
    -FAST - most recent update was fast (incremental)
    -NA - materialized view don't have not yet been updated (for example, if it was created to DEFERRED payment)

    The index on a materialized view, like the index on a table, will be maintained when DML such as refresh occurs. You could potentially improve a full refresh speed by removing the index before the update and re-create them after the update (especially if you do a transactional refresh). But if the update happens the morning before that people are around and you have a window refresh reasonable, can you get any.
